Abstract

This article discusses the issues of organizing the process of preparing students for career choice at the primary education stage based on humanistic principles. The importance of personality-oriented education, taking into account the interests and abilities of students, ensuring the right to free choice, and supporting individual development in career guidance is analyzed. According to the results of the study, pedagogical activities based on humanistic principles serve to form professional interests in primary school students and expand their ideas about future professions.
